From his first film,fertile memoryla memoire fertile aldhakira alkhisba, 1980, michel khleifi displays the narrativedocumentary style that he goes on to develop to such great effect. This shift, which reflected the increasing importance of land as a symbol of palestinian identity and nationality, was initially manifested in the works of directors who lived in israel and could film there mainly in the films of michel khleifi. Farah hatoum, a 50year old widow living in northern israel and sahar khalifeh, a divorcee living with her daughter in the israeli occupied west bank.
